This report summarizes the results from three programs for the production of highly enriched U/sup 235/ by the electromagnetic process. Products and enrichments obtained are: (1) 80 grams of 99.9% U/sup 235/, (2) 1100 grams of 99.7% U/sup 235/ and (3) 8 grams of 99.994% U/sup 235/. These materials have been made available for use on Atomic Energy Commission projects. An analysis of certain features of the process is made for its possible use in the separation of mass fractions 233 and 235 from 232, 234, and 235. (auth)
